January 6, 2002
Participation in the Blessing Service for the Interfaith
Meditation Prayer Room, at the CentraCare Health Plaza.
Various religion representataives were there to offer their prayers.
Since it was an opening of the Interfaith Prayer room, Norhashimah offered
a prayer from Surah Fatiha (The Opening), and chanted it in
Arabic and translated it in English. It was a beautiful ceremony.
Nothing is more beautiful than having people from various
religions sharing their prayers in peace and harmony.
The fact that the Centra Care facility dedicated a room as
an Interfaith prayer room, shows that it realizes the importance
of, and acknowledges the diversity of faiths that exists
in the community.
